Apple Mac OS X up to 10.10.3 Spotlight command injection

A vulnerability was found in Apple Mac OS X up to 10.10.3 (Operating System) and classified as problematic. Affected by this issue is an unknown code of the component Spotlight.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a command injection v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-77. The product constructs all or part of a command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ended command when it is sent to a downstream component.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

Spotlight in Apple OS X before 10.10.4 allows attackers to execute arbitrary commands via a crafted name of a photo file within the local photo library.

The weakness was disclosed 07/03/2015 by Emil Kvarnhammar with Zero Day Initiative (Website). The advisory is available at lists.apple.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2015-3716 since 05/07/2015. The exploitation is known to be difficult. Local access is required to approach this attack.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available. This vulnerability is assigned to T1202 by the MITRE ATT&CK project.

The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 84488 (Mac OS X 10.10.x < 10.10.4 Multiple Vulnerabilities (GHOST) (Logjam)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family MacOS X Local Security Checks.

Upgrading to version 10.10.4 eliminates this vulnerability.

The vulnerability is also documented in the vulnerability database at Tenable (84488). The entries 75568, 76185, 76186 and 76187 are pretty similar.
